Mr Murray inquires about funding for traffic management at the Throssell Street and Prinsep Street intersection in Collie for 2012-2013 and 2013-2014. The response indicates no funding was allocated, but a joint review is planned.

I refer to the intersection of Throssell Street and Prinsep Street in the Shire of Collie and ask:
(a) what funding was budgeted in 2012–2013 for the assessment and placement of traffic management devices at this section of road, and:
(i) if applicable, of the budgeted funds, have any been acquitted; and
(ii) if no funding was budgeted, why not; and
(b) is funding proposed for the intersection of Throssell Street and Prinsep Street in the Shire of Collie, in the 2013–2014 Budget, and:
(i) if applicable, how much funding has been allocated and over what time frame;
(ii) if applicable, of this funding allocation, what specific project will be funded; and
(iii) if not, why not?

(a) Nil (a)(i) Not applicable (a)(ii) Traffic signals are not considered to be necessary or desirable at this location by Main Roads. (b) No (b)(i) Not applicable (b)(ii) Not applicable (b)(iii) Main Roads has recently met with the Shire of Collie at officer level and will undertake a joint review of Throssell Street through Collie, including this intersection. Any upgrade recommendations resulting from this review will be considered for funding in future budgets.
